Betty Anne Whitfield, 87, Altoona, passed away Sunday morning at UPMC Altoona. She was born in Greensburg, daughter of the late Jacob and Lorene (Rose) Brown.
She was preceded in death by her loving husband, Charles L. Whitfield, on Dec. 29, 2018. They were married on Aug. 17, 1957, in Greensburg.
Surviving are two children, Douglas A. Whitfield and Amy B. Whitfield, both of Altoona; and five grandchildren: Brad, Brooke, Brady, Bryce and Kaylee.
In addition to her husband, she was also preceded in death by two children, Cheryl Ann and Gregory Scott.
Betty was a 1953 graduate of Greensburg High School. She graduated from Waynesburg College with a B.A. in Elementary Education.
She was a teacher from 1958-61, and then devoted her time to her family.
Betty was a member of Wehnwood United Methodist Church. She was an avid Penn State and Steelers football fan, and enjoyed painting watercolors, traveling and spending time with family and friends.
